Jeremy Matthew Sipe, 44, of Elkton, passed away Tuesday, July 29, 2025 at his home surrounded by his loving family. He was born November 9, 1980 in Rockingham County, Virginia and was the son of Wayne Junior Sipe and Laura (Mofield) Sipe.

Jeremy was preceded in death by his grandparents, Robert "Bob" and Louise Sipe, Pearl Elizabeth Coffey.

On December 8, 2001, he married his best friend, Bilita Nicole Sipe, who survives.

Jeremy was a graduate of Spotswood High School and a member of Bible Holiness Church. He was the founder and CEO since 2014 of Project Holy Nations. He will be missed by all those who knew and loved him. He was truly one of a kind. In the words of one of his Kenyan friends; he was more than a friend. He was a father figure, a servant to many and a pillar of strength and kindness in our lives. Jeremy gave selflessly, always ready to lift others even when no one asked. His heart was generous and his wisdom left lasting marks on everyone fortunate enough to know him. His absence leaves a space that cannot be filled but his legacy of love, service and strength will continue to live in all of us. We will carry his memory forward, inspired by the way he lived; with humility, compassion and unwavering faith. Jeremy loved fishing, cars, music and traveling but most of all, he loved his wife, his boy and Jesus.

In addition to his wife, he is survived by his son, Thomas Watson Sipe; brother, Jonathan Sipe and wife, Clairen; nieces and nephew, Reagan, Mason and Addilyn Sipe; father-in-law, Rev. William Watson and wife, Anita as well as many friends from around the world.

A Funeral Service will be conducted 2 p.m., Sunday, August 3, 2025 at Bible Holiness Church in Elkton, with Pastor Brent Gabbard officiating. Burial to follow at Elk Run Cemetery.

Visitation will be 6 to 8 p.m., Saturday, August 2, 2025 at the church.
